A story is told about an Ethiopian goat herder named Kaldi, in the Kaffe region of Ethiopia, about 800 AD. After consuming the red berries, he noted how alert and animated his goats became and how they even stayed awake during the night. Whether true or not, we do know that if we want to stay awake, alert, alive, and enthusiastic at night , coffee is typically the first thing that comes to mind as a solution .

While these benefits of drinking coffee are exciting, remember that moderation is key. Also for some people, coffee can cause irritability, nervousness, and anxiety when taken in high doses. It can also affect the quality of your sleep or may cause insomnia. I have a friend who seems to be allergic to coffee. Whenever she takes more than two or three sips, she feels as though there is a thick lump in her throat which gives her discomfort.

Usually, it takes about six hours for the effects of the caffeine to wear off so keep that in mind when drinking coffee, especially at night, unless you intend to stay up all night. If you are planning to lessen your intake, do it gradually. Avoid doing cold turkey quitting as it can lead to undesirable withdrawal symptoms such as headaches and fatigue that may last for days.
